Data produced by SMG/KRC indicates that 11% of Polish homes had HDTV sets as of June 2008, as opposed to 6% a year earlier.
At the same time, the number of households with internet access rose to 38%. ADSL connections remain the most popular, accounting for 37% of the total, and were particularly high (56%) in rural parts of the country.
One in four homes were receiving internet services via cable as of June this year (up from 22% a year earlier), with the highest concentrations (51%) being found in cities with a population of over 500,000.
